Feel the Pain Guitar Lesson – Dinosaur Jr.

In this guitar lesson video for "Feel the Pain", I will show you how to play this hit song by Dinosaur Jr. note-for-note.

The tuning is standard tuning (E A D G B E) with a capo at the 3rd fret.

There are TWO instantly recognizable guitar riffs in this one. One is heard during the intro and verse and is very easy to play. The second one is more challenging but equally fun.

I will go through each section of the song in the order that each appears on the original recording.

The last thing we will cover is J Mascis' great guitar solo that closes out the song. I will show you how to play that solo note-for-note.

I Stand Alone Guitar Lesson – Godsmack

In this guitar lesson video for I Stand Alone, I will show you how to play this smash hit by Godsmack note-for-note.

The tuning is drop C tuning. That is, starting from the sixth string C G C F A D.

We will start the lesson with that instantly recognizable guitar riff then go through the entire song from there covering everything in the order it appears on the original recording.

"I Stand Alone" is pretty easy to play after you get the rhythm of the main riff down, which can be a little tricky along with it being played in probably the hardest part of the fretboard to navigate. It is also tons of fun to play because it simply rocks.
